1991 Accord wagon: Intermittent stalling issues
My wife's 91 Accord is having issues. It randomly stalls while driving, which is obviously not desirable. If it sits for a minute, it starts right back up and drives on like nothing is wrong. It's very intermittent, as in it has only done it 3 or 4 times over the past 2 months.
Previous to this issue, it had completely died and wouldn't start at all. I replaced the main relay, which seemed to fix it since it started right back up. I also replaced the cap/rotor/plugs/wires for good measure while I was working on it (they were about due anyway).
So fast forward to now, like I said, it's still randomly stalling while driving, but always starts back up after a couple minutes. Any ideas for what else I should be looking for? Thanks for any help

hmm my guess would have been the main relay as well. hows your ignition coil looking. you have done distributor work so its possible timing or something else got knocked off. check your ignitor. check for free play on your spade connectors. whatever it is, it sounds like its electrical. you can also try out http://www.accordwagonclub.com...de07d. in the past i have found it helpful.
